Reported on Item485.

ClassMethod, StaticMethod? , ObjectMethod? are a group of orphan pages, not relevant to normal documentation?

Answer

Good question. They were added recently by Gilmar. They link to each other but add no value to and end user or sysadmin. They are developer docs. So I leave them on SVN but remove them from distribution.

Action - remove from MANIFEST

-- KennethLavrsen - 17 Dec 2008

These topics are not orphans.

All the POD documentation in-line in code uses ClassMethod? , StaticMethod? etc to indicate the type of the method. When a POD document is generated (via %INCLUDE{"doc:Foswiki::Meta"}% for example) the rendered document links to these definitions. Visit DevelopingPlugins and click Foswiki::Meta to see the effect of removing them.

They are required for documentation of the APIs, so I recommend you revert this checkin. Re-opened the report and raised to Urgent.

-- CrawfordCurrie - 17 Dec 2008

I see now why both I and the reporter saw them orphaned. They are called from generated content. Not from a static topic. So the backlink feature cannot find the parent.

Reverted and closing

-- KennethLavrsen - 17 Dec 2008

The copyright of the content on this website is held by the contributing authors, except where stated elsewhere. see CopyrightStatement. Creative Commons LicenseGet Foswiki at sourceforge.net. Fast, secure and Free Open Source software downloads